Comparison: Xtrfy M42 Wireless vs Alienware AW320M

The Xtrfy M42 Wireless is a wireless symmetrical gaming mouse with right-handed compatibility. It features 7 buttons, weighs 67 grams, and has dimensions of 119mm in length, 63mm in width, and 38mm in height. It is equipped with a PAW3370 sensor supporting up to 19,000 DPI, with a maximum polling rate of 1,000 Hz. On the other hand, the Alienware AW320M is a wired symmetrical gaming mouse with right-handed compatibility. It comes with 6 buttons, weighs 74 grams, and has dimensions of 125.2mm in length, 61.7mm in width, and 37.8mm in height. It features a PAW3370 sensor with up to 19,000 DPI, and offers a polling rate of 1,000 Hz.

The Alienware AW320M is 5.2% more in length, -2.1% less in width, and -0.5% less in height compared to the Xtrfy M42 Wireless. Additionally, the Alienware AW320M is 10.4% heavier compared to the Xtrfy M42 Wireless.
